    Hi everyone I have recently acquired a new toy,she is 50" long 8.5" wide, the tallest mast is 52" .She is plank on frame construction,according to markings inside the hull she was made in 1996 by Dave Barrow.If anyone can help with any more information it would be much appreciated ,Cheers Chris.
